Abstract

An improved synthesis of a highly potent vitamin D3 analog, 24, 24-difluoro-1α, 25-dihydroxyvitamin D3 (1b)has been accomplished via vitamin D2-SO2 adducts. The introduction of fluorine atoms was performed by treating the α-keto ester (11) with diethylaminosulfur trifluoride. The total yield was 12.5% from inexpensive vitamin D2 in 11 steps. This sequence is sufficiently straightforward to be conducted on a gram scale.
